Latest Patents
Birgit Stman holds a patent for a method for the manufacture of products containing fibers of lignocellulosic material. This method involves the disintegration of lignocellulosic material into fibers, followed by the formation and pressing of the fiber web into products, preferably in the form of fiberboard. The process includes impregnating the fibers with lignin in conjunction with water, maintaining a pH that does not substantially exceed 12.5. This innovative technique ensures that the lignin is fixed against leaching by water, transforming it into an essentially water-insoluble form.
